What are the natural products of calabarzon?

Calabarzon, a region in the Philippines, is rich in natural products due to its diverse ecosystems. Key natural products include agricultural crops like rice, coconut, and various fruits such as bananas and mangoes. The region is also known for its herbal plants, fishery products, and minerals. Additionally, Calabarzon's forests provide timber and non-timber forest products, contributing to both local livelihoods and the economy.

What are the best products of calabarzon?

Calabarzon, a region in the Philippines, is known for its diverse agricultural products and handicrafts. Notable products include Cavite's coffee, especially the Barako variety, and Batangas' beef and dairy products. Quezon Province is famous for its coconut-based products like Buko pie and espasol, while Laguna is known for its buko (young coconut) products and the sweet delicacies of the region. Additionally, the region produces high-quality woodcrafts and furniture, particularly from the town of Lumban in Laguna.

What is calabarzon?

Calabarzon is a region in the Philippines located in the southern part of Luzon. It is an acronym derived from the provinces it comprises: Cavite, Laguna, Batangas, Rizal, and Quezon. Calabarzon is known for its beautiful beaches, historic sites, and thriving industries.
